Creamy Gnocchi with Spinach (Printable Version)

Tender gnocchi in a luscious cream sauce with sun-dried tomatoes, spinach, and Parmesan cheese.

# Everything You’ll Need:

→ Main Ingredients

01 - 1 tablespoon olive oil
02 - 2 medium cloves garlic, minced
03 - 2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
04 - 1 1/2 cups vegetable broth
05 - 16 ounces potato gnocchi
06 - 1/2 cup sun-dried tomatoes, drained and chopped
07 - 1/8 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
08 - 1/8 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
09 - 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per, plus more to taste
10 - 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ese, plus additional for serving
11 - 2/3 cup heavy whipping cream
12 - 2 cups baby spinach, roughly chopped
13 - 5 to 6 fresh basil leaves, chiffonaded

# Steps to Cook:

01 - Heat olive oil in a large sauté pan over medium-low heat. Add minced garlic and Italian seasoning, cooking until fragrant and tender, about 2 minutes.
02 - Pour in vegetable broth, then add gnocchi, sun-dried tomatoes, crushed red pepper flakes, kosher salt, and black pepper.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at, cover, and simmer until gnocchi are tender, approximately 8 to 10 minutes.
03 - Stir in the chopped baby spinach and cook until wilted. Add grated Parmesan cheese, heavy cream, and chiffonaded basil leaves. Stir to combine and adjust seasoning to taste.
04 - Plate the gnocchi and garnish with additional Parmesan cheese and basil leaves. Serve immediately.

# Extra Suggestions:

01 - For spicier depth, increase the crushed red pepper flakes to taste.
